Loving What We Hate with Ryan Neiswender
Today we have the pleasure of interviewing the inspiring Ryan Neiswender, a paralympic basketball player, on the topic of perseverance, overcoming obstacles, and resilience. Ryan takes us on his journey of embracing who he is, being introduced to paralympic basketball, and developing the mental toughness necessary to succeed in the sport. He shares his experience in Tokyo and feeling alone, while also demonstrating "expectancy theory", where that which you focus on, expands.
Ryan discusses the importance of attacking life one day at a time and breaking things up while still having long-term goals. He explains how vision gives us the motivation to pursue our dreams and how we can all learn from his story of choosing to keep fighting.
